Mission Statement

Our Mission: Since 1973 our mission has been to empower the Latino/Hispanic community within Michiana by providing educational, cultural and advocacy services in a welcoming, bilingual environment.

About This Cause

We are a charitable organization that functions as a community center on the west side of South Bend. It was founded by Fr. John Phalen in October of 1973 as a youth outreach program in response to the many needs of area Hispanic teenagers. La Casa now offers varied programs in an effort to edify Hispanic youth and adults in development of leadership skills, increase knowledge and appreciation of their own culture, and develop stronger self-esteem, encouraging fuller participation as community members. In 1975, the organization incorporated as a not for profit corporation with a full-time staff, establishing it‘s home since 1980 at 746 S. Meade St. La Casa de Amistad offers vital educational and lifeskills based programming for the Hispanic/Latino community and its neighbors in Michiana. Today, La Casa de Amistad continues to grow and expand in response to the needs of its clients, utilizing current trends in education and informational services/resources. In doing so, La Casa is better able to serve our neighbors, by helping people prepare successfully for the workforce and daily life in our community.
